比特币的技术形态
比特币是一种数字货币,其背后使用了一系列创新性的技术来实现去中心化、安全性和匿名性等特点。了解比特币的技术形态能帮助我们更好地理解其工作原理。
区块链技术
比特币的核心技术是区块链,它是一个由区块构成的分布式账本。每个区块包含了一定数量的交易记录,并通过密码学哈希函数与前一个区块链接在一起,形成了一个链式结构。这种去中心化的账本机制确保了交易的透明性和防篡改性。
工作量证明
比特币使用了工作量证明(Proof of Work)机制来确保网络的安全性。矿工需要通过解决一个复杂的数学难题来验证交易并创建新的区块。这个过程需要大量的计算能力和电力消耗,使得攻击者很难篡改历史交易记录。
去中心化的网络
比特币网络是一个去中心化的网络,没有中央机构控制交易的发行和验证。每个节点都可以成为网络的一部分,共同参与交易的验证和区块的创建。这种去中心化的特点使得比特币无法被单一实体或政府控制,增加了其抗审查和抗封锁的能力。
匿名性与隐私保护
比特币在交易上提供了一定程度的匿名性,但实际上是一种伪匿名的系统。所有的交易信息都是公开的,可以被追溯,但没有直接与真实身份相连接。为了进一步保护用户的隐私,一些额外的隐私保护技术也被加入到了比特币的生态系统中。
智能合约
除了基本的货币交易功能,比特币还支持智能合约的功能。智能合约是一种自动执行的合约,可以在没有第三方的情况下进行验证、执行和管理。这为去中心化的应用和金融服务提供了更多的可能性。